Domanda

Qual è la loro posizione ufficiale nei confronti del clojure?

È stato utile?

Soluzione

Il caso di successo più ottimistico per Clojure è probabilmente definito rispetto alle altre varianti di Lisp. Se Clojure dovesse guidare l'esercito di Lisp (improbabile, BTW, ma questa è un'altra domanda) non avrebbe comunque molto effetto economico.

E se non ha molto effetto economico, allora non avrà davvero una saggezza convenzionale all'interno di una società. Agli individui piacerà e non piacerà, ma come azienda, in un modo o nell'altro non se ne cureranno.

Se l'inferno dovesse congelarsi e poi tutti iniziassero a svilupparsi a Clojure, la società probabilmente non si sarebbe ancora preoccupata , avrebbero solo trovato un modo per adattarsi e vivere nel nuovo ecosistema. Col passare del tempo, si sarebbe sviluppata una storia su come fosse stata tutta la loro idea per cominciare.

Altri suggerimenti

Perché Sun / Oracle (nel suo insieme), gli empoye o uno qualsiasi dei milioni di utenti di tali librerie Java o JVM dovrebbero preoccuparsi di Clojure tranne che Clojure è vantaggioso (o dannoso) per le singole attività?

La domanda è, nella migliore delle ipotesi, sciocca.

Clojure non sostituirà Java - non era nemmeno progettato per - e, semmai, mostra semplicemente l'adattabilità della JVM (e gli strati di hack utilizzati per supportare i linguaggi dinamici in modi relativamente efficienti). Speriamo che la JVM prospererà e migliorerà (e avrà un supporto migliore per i modelli di programmazione "non Java").

Non vi è alcun motivo per cui il sole potrebbe essere "non troppo eccitato". sulle lingue alternative JVM (e ci sono molte altre lingue oltre a Clojure: Groovy, Scala, JRuby, Jython, persino JavaFX, che proviene dallo stesso Sun).

Penso che tutti questi nuovi linguaggi siano importanti per la JVM e Sun stia lavorando attivamente per aggiungere supporto nella JVM per linguaggi di programmazione alternativi (vedere JSR 292 , ad esempio).

Non è come se Sun volesse che tutti usassero solo il linguaggio di programmazione Java ...

Il sole non è una sola mente. Troverai opinioni sul clojure che si trovano su tutta la mappa:
http: / /www.google.com/search?source=ig&hl=en&rlz=&q=site%3Ablogs.oracle.com+clojure&aq=f&oq=&aqi=


E non dimenticare che molti linguaggi non Java in esecuzione sulla JVM possono trarre vantaggio da quelle vaste librerie, sia all'interno della JDK che senza. Penso che Sun generalmente approvi tale riutilizzo.

Non conosco nessun " ufficiale " posizione di Clojure. Potresti aver visto rapporti di lavoro sul supporto di linguaggi dinamici sulla JVM e sull'hosting di vertici sulle lingue JVM nel campus di Santa Clara. L'atteggiamento generale sembra essere, se vuoi fare un po 'di programmazione, per favore, vieni e fallo sulla JVM.

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top